One Voice
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 1,771,869 | 1,433,524 | 338,345 | 9.9 | 28% |
| 2012 | 1,558,727 | 1,681,308 | −122,581 | 5.0 | 33% |
| 2013 | 2,202,004 | 2,148,479 | 53,525 | 5.0 | 30% |
| 2014 | 2,669,078 | 1,774,525 | 894,553 | 12.2 | 39% |
| 2015 | 900,164 | 1,635,347 | −735,183 | 7.8 | 41% |
| 2016 | 2,051,446 | 1,701,619 | 349,827 | 9.8 | 46% |
| 2017 | 1,934,496 | 1,590,484 | 344,012 | 11.2 | 37% |
| 2018 | 2,002,535 | 1,649,244 | 353,291 | 13.4 | 35% |
| 2019 | 2,259,258 | 1,594,580 | 664,678 | 18.9 | 31% |
| 2020 | 3,150,716 | 1,764,612 | 1,386,104 | 26.5 | 28% |
| 2021 | 4,517,134 | 2,137,736 | 2,379,398 | 35.2 | 33% |
| 2022 | 3,475,098 | 2,852,903 | 622,195 | 29.0 | 26% |
| 2023 | 5,177,453 | 3,816,166 | 1,361,287 | 26.0 | 24%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$1,361,287 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 26 months of spending, up from 9.9 in 2011. Staff pay was 24% of spending. $685,640 of its net assets are donor-restricted.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
